Hallo,
bin gerade etwas verblüfft, dass ich nach fast 30-minütiger Suche keine Funktion finden kann, mit der man die Systemvariable "TEMP" auflösen kann.
Zur Erklärung: Ich möchte den Temp-Ordner des Systems ermitteln (NICHT den des Benutzers, siehe Anhang). Standardmäßig liegt der unter "C:\Windows\Temp\", aber über die Umgebungsvariablen kann das jeder Benutzer anpassen.
Mit
Delphi-Quelltext
1:
| ExpandEnvironmentStrings(PChar('%temp%'), PChar(result), MAX_PATH); |
kann ich die Umgebungsvariable des Benutzers auslesen, aber eben NICHT die Systemvariable.
Hat da jemand eine Idee?
Danke und viele Grüße
Andy